The Resume

    (August 16, 1941- )
    Born in Cheadle Heath, Cheshire, England, United Kingdom
    Birth name was David Gulesserian
    Antiques dealer and television presenter
    Hosted 'The Antiques Show' (1998-2000), 'Bargain Hunt' (2000-04), and 'Dickinson's Real Deal' (2006- )

Why he might be annoying:

    He has the same perma-tan look as George Hamilton.
    When he was nineteen, he went to jail for mail fraud, and served three years.
    When he was first presented with the premise for 'Bargain Hunt,' 'I thought it was actually the biggest load of rubbish I had ever heard.'
    His catchphrases are 'a real bobby-dazzler' (for a particularly impressive find) and 'cheap as chips' (for a bargain).
    His daytime talk show lasted for less than a year (2003).

Why he might not be annoying:

    He was given up for adoption as an infant.
    He later found out the identity of his birth mother and corresponded with her for two decades, but she refused to ever meet him.
    He has been married to Lorne Lesley for over fifty years.
    He takes jokes about his appearance ('Terry Wogan called me the secret love child of Peter Stringfellow and a mahogany hat stand') in stride: 'It's not like anyone is being really horrible to me. And I've realized, in a commercial sense, that all the things they say actually promote me.'
